Question: 5year old female with back pain and fever of 105 and complaining her peepee hurts
Brief Answer:
She needs to be seen now.
Detailed Answer:
Hello XXXXXXX
Your daughter may have a urinary tract infection that may be involving the kidneys. This would cause back pain (especially in the flanks) and urinary pain and fever.
This is a very high fever, and a kidney infection, if that is what it is, needs to be addressed immediately. I advise you take her in to the ER now.
